The 70mm fan size provides an optimal balance between airflow volume and noise generation, making it suitable for both office workstations and server environments where thermal management is critical for system stability and longevity.\u003c\/p\u003e\n\n\u003ch2\u003eKey Specifications\u003c\/h2\u003e\n\u003ctable\u003e\n\u003ctr\u003e\n\u003ctd\u003eSpecification\u003c\/td\u003e\n\u003ctd\u003eDetails\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eProduct Type\u003c\/td\u003e\n\u003ctd\u003eCPU Cooler with Integrated Heatsink and Fan\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eBrand\u003c\/td\u003e\n\u003ctd\u003eZebronics\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eSocket Compatibility\u003c\/td\u003e\n\u003ctd\u003eLGA 478 Socket\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eProcessor Support\u003c\/td\u003e\n\u003ctd\u003eIntel Pentium 4, Celeron-D, and compatible variants\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eFan Size\u003c\/td\u003e\n\u003ctd\u003e70mm diameter axial fan\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eHeatsink Material\u003c\/td\u003e\n\u003ctd\u003eAluminum with optimized fin geometry\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eBase Plate\u003c\/td\u003e\n\u003ctd\u003ePrecision-machined direct contact design\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eMounting Mechanism\u003c\/td\u003e\n\u003ctd\u003eSocket 478 retention bracket system\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eOrigin\u003c\/td\u003e\n\u003ctd\u003eOriginal and Authentic\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eWarranty\u003c\/td\u003e\n\u003ctd\u003e7 days on manufacturing defects\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eShipping\u003c\/td\u003e\n\u003ctd\u003e1-5 days from Bengaluru\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eDelivery\u003c\/td\u003e\n\u003ctd\u003e7-8 days across India\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eSupport\u003c\/td\u003e\n\u003ctd\u003e24\/7 via Email and WhatsApp\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003c\/table\u003e\n\n\u003ch2\u003eKey Features\u003c\/h2\u003e\n\u003cul\u003e\n\u003cli\u003e70mm High-Performance Axial Fan: Delivers optimized airflow with low noise generation, maintaining CPU temperatures within safe operating ranges during continuous workloads\u003c\/li\u003e\n\u003cli\u003eAluminum Heatsink with Optimized Fin Design: Maximizes surface area for enhanced heat dissipation through forced convection cooling principles\u003c\/li\u003e\n\u003cli\u003eDirect Contact Base Plate: Precision-machined mounting surface ensures uniform thermal transfer from CPU heat spreader to heatsink structure\u003c\/li\u003e\n\u003cli\u003eSocket 478 Secure Mounting: Integrated retention bracket system provides stable attachment without thermal resistance from loose mounting\u003c\/li\u003e\n\u003cli\u003eDurable Construction: Quality aluminum heatsink with reliable fan bearing technology ensures extended operational lifespan across multiple thermal cycles\u003c\/li\u003e\n\u003cli\u003eLegacy System Compatibility: Purpose-designed for Intel Pentium 4 and Celeron-D processors in Socket 478 configurations\u003c\/li\u003e\n\u003c\/ul\u003e\n\n\u003ch2\u003eApplications and Use Cases\u003c\/h2\u003e\n\u003cul\u003e\n\u003cli\u003eDesktop Workstation Thermal Management: Maintains optimal CPU temperatures for Pentium 4 based systems running productivity applications, CAD software, and office workloads requiring sustained processing power\u003c\/li\u003e\n\u003cli\u003eServer and Network Equipment Cooling: Provides reliable heat dissipation in legacy server environments where Celeron-D processors are deployed for network services and data processing tasks\u003c\/li\u003e\n\u003cli\u003eComputer Repair and System Integration: Essential replacement cooler for technicians refurbishing Socket 478 systems or upgrading thermal solutions in existing installations\u003c\/li\u003e\n\u003cli\u003eOverclocking and Performance Tuning: Supports moderate performance optimization on Pentium 4 platforms by maintaining stable CPU temperatures during elevated clock frequency operations\u003c\/li\u003e\n\u003cli\u003eIndustrial Computing Applications: Ensures thermal stability in embedded systems and industrial control computers utilizing Socket 478 processors in temperature-controlled environments\u003c\/li\u003e\n\u003c\/ul\u003e\n\n\u003ch2\u003eHow to Use\u003c\/h2\u003e\n\u003cp\u003eBegin installation by powering down the system completely and allowing the CPU to cool to ambient temperature. Locate the Socket 478 retention mechanism on the motherboard and carefully position the heatsink base plate directly over the CPU heat spreader, ensuring full contact across the entire surface. Secure the mounting bracket by engaging the retention clips with the socket retention arms, applying even pressure to ensure the heatsink sits flush against the processor. Connect the fan power connector to the CPU fan header on the motherboard, typically labeled CPUFAN, ensuring the connector is fully seated for proper power delivery.\u003c\/p\u003e\n\n\u003cp\u003eAfter installation, apply thermal paste between the CPU heat spreader and heatsink base plate if not pre-applied, using a thin uniform layer approximately 1mm thick. Power on the system and monitor CPU temperatures using BIOS monitoring tools or third-party software to verify proper thermal operation. Typical operating temperatures for Pentium 4 processors should remain below 65 degrees Celsius under normal workloads. Periodically inspect the fan for dust accumulation and clean the heatsink fins with compressed air every 3-6 months to maintain optimal airflow and cooling performance.\u003c\/p\u003e\n\n\u003ch2\u003eFrequently Asked Questions\u003c\/h2\u003e\n\u003cdetails\u003e\n\u003csummary\u003eIs this cooler compatible with all Socket 478 processors?\u003c\/summary\u003e\n\u003cp\u003eYes, this Zebronics cooler is designed for universal Socket 478 compatibility and works with all Intel Pentium 4, Celeron-D, and compatible processors using the LGA 478 socket.
